建立高效液相色谱串联质谱法(HPLC-ESI-MS/MS)同时测定松萝中松萝酸、地弗地衣酸、拉马酸3种主要有效成分的含量。采用Agilent ZORBAX SB-C18色谱柱(4.6 mm×250 mm,5μm),流动相为甲醇(0.05%甲酸)-水(0.05%甲酸-4 mmol乙酸铵),等度洗脱,流速0.8 m L·min~(-1)。采用正负离子切换模式,多反应监测(MRM)进行定量测定,在负离子条件下测定松萝酸和地弗地衣酸,在正离子条件下测定拉马酸。结果上述3种主要成分在进样量范围内呈良好线性(r>0.997 9);平均回收率为95.0%~105.1%,RSD为1.1%~5.2%。该方法简便、快速、准确、重复性好,为综合评价松萝的质量提供参考。
